Hogwarts Legacy clearly saved the best for last, as one of the game's final secrets has reminded fans just how much care and attention the developers put into this open world.

Since releasing back in February, the Harry Potter RPG has dominated conversations and sales charts, and looks likely to be the biggest (if not the best) video game of 2023. While many have argued there's no way Hogwarts Legacy is competing with the likes of Baldur's Gate 3 and The Legend Of Zelda: Tears Of The Kingdom when the GOTY argument rolls around in a few months, fans have had plenty of fun with the adventure.

Take a look at the attention to detail in Hogwarts Legacy below!

Advert

Hogwarts Legacy is a huge game filled with secrets, of course, but there's every chance you might have missed one of the game's best and last hidden gems - that's because one player stumbled across it quite by chance.

“I discovered by accident that using the transformation spell on classic animals turns them into objects!” posted by Redditor Eskylos, along with some brilliant screenshots. Stag are transformed into beer kegs with antlers, cats become balls of yarn, and cows become milk carts. Is this animal abuse? We'd assume the creatures eventually revert back to their normal selves, however another user pointed out if you use the same spell on animal enough times in a row, they'll transform into a bag of gold for you to pocket. That seems pretty evil.

"I saw someone do this and then levitate them above a trolls head, hitting the troll. It did insane damage," one user pointed out.

Anyway, if you're dead set on being a properly evil little shit then you might as well jump back into Hogwarts Legacy and try this out. Just know that we're all judging you behind your back, okay? Okay.
